Lactate dehydrogenase, chicken Heart
Lactate dehydrogenase, chicken heart (LAD, LD, LDH, LAD chicken heart, LD chicken heart, LDH chicken heart) is a lactate dehydrogenase. Lactate dehydrogenase, chicken heart helps cells convert carbohydrates into energy and belongs to the heart-type isoenzyme category.
